due to server migration and removal of svn repositories on springrts.com there is currently no up to date source code of TASClient.

As i got no repsonse to the request of using the repository i've setup for TASClient development and distributing GPL'ed binaries without up-to date source code is a GPL-License violation i request the maintainer of TASClient to use https://github.com/spring-archive/TASClient (or an other public source code hosting service).

please pm me if you have questions / need help for getting permissions to the repository. basicly i just need the github user name to give permissions to the repository.

Please do this within two weeks or i've to remove tasclient binaries from springrts.com/springfiles.com.

I hope its understandable that a deadline is needed when requests are ignored.

(side note: this way others could contribute to TASClient / or maybe maintain it)
